BAC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2021 in Review

2,489 of the 5,746 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Bank of America (BAC) for Q2 2021, worth a combined $292B — up 23% from $237B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 158 funds opened new BAC positions and 117 closed out — a net gain of 41 holders — while 1,031 added to existing stakes and 1,012 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$1.57B. The largest seller was Viking Global Investors, cutting an estimated $989M.
